Surepoint is looking for a skilled Electrical Estimator to join our team in Nisku, Alberta. In this role, you'll be responsible for preparing precise and timely full-cost estimates for electrical projects, covering both materials and labor. You'll manage multiple bids simultaneously,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and on-time submission.
Key Responsibilities
•Prepare comprehensive electrical estimates, from conceptual design to detailed tenders, including material take-offs, labor, and equipment costs.
•Complete the entire bidding process, which involves analyzing bid packages and scope of work, and collecting and analyzing quotes from suppliers and subcontractors.
•Identify and quantify project risks, allocate contingencies, and suggest optimal solutions based on cost, quality, and material availability.
•Collaborate closely with internal teams to determine costs for RFIs and additional work orders.
•Present and review estimates with stakeholders ensuring alignment and clear communication.
•Prepare detailed cost estimates for scope changes and change notices identified during project execution.
•Participate in bid strategy discussions, project kick-off, and close-out meetings.
•Maintain thorough documentation for estimates, ensuring all bids adhere to proper guidelines and codes.
•Liaise with electrical suppliers, manufacturers, engineers, and lighting agencies to secure competitive pricing and validate material costs.
